Continual Updating of Knowledge Level 1 Recognize the importance of gaining knowledge by: o Attending orientation o Studying training materials on early childhood education and care o Participating in additional opportunities to increase competency for working with young children and families P 2.9.1 Level 2 Implement a professional development plan that includes gaining additional knowledge and skills through approved professional development activities and other activities such as: o Seeking and using feedback from other professionals o Journaling & reflection o Reading professional publications o Staff development workshops o Professional organizations o Formal course work P 2.9.2 Level 3 Develop, plan, select, and/or create various models of professional development. Promote the professional growth of others through modeling, consulting, and mentoring. P 2.9.3 Level 4 Analyze, evaluate, and modify systems to support the career development of teaching and administrative staff, incorporating adult learning theory, personal and organizational change theory, and current research in early childhood education. Expand learning opportunities through traditional and electronic delivery systems. P 2.9.4 Level 5 Analyze, evaluate, articulate, and apply evidence-based best practices regarding complex development theories and rationale for early childhood care and education. P 2.9.5
